@PrivateTim One of our National holidays will be this coming week, 25th April, ANZAC day, we have 2 remembrance days, the other one is the 11th November. Non USA readers may not know that your Memorial Day is for the same purpose, honouring those who over the centuries have given their lives for the safety of their countries and others. Their is a phrase used in these circumstances "Least We Forget "
